QuickField is a very efficient Finite Element Analysis package for electromagnetic, thermal, and stress design simulation with coupled multi-field analysis. It combines a family of analysis modules using the latest solver technology with a very user-friendly model editor (preprocessor) and a powerful postprocessor.

QuickField requires no training - you may start using it as soon as it is installed on your computer, without knowing the mathematical algorithms used and details of their implementation.

QuickField is a native Windows® application, which was designed for this platform only. It fully utilizes the advantages of a modern operational environment. It is very compact, yet powerful, and can be used for many design applications which require Magnetic , Electric or Thermostructural analysis

QuickField can be effectively applied to many engineering tasks. Most often, it is used in the design of electric motors, turbine generators, actuators, speakers, transformers, induction heating systems, transmission lines and other complex electrical and electromechanical devices.

On Apple Silicon Macs (M1, M2), the bundled x64 version of Zulu runs through Apple’s Rosetta translation layer, often causing stuttering. The Indie Stone has confirmed that Project Zomboid is currently an . Replacing only the JVM is insufficient, as every native library (e.g., LWJGL, OpenGL) would also need ARM64 versions, which is a substantial undertaking for the small development team at this time.

If Windows asks to allow "Zulu Platform x64 Architecture" to communicate on your network, you should Allow it. This is necessary for hosting or joining multiplayer servers.
